Cogent Biosciences reported a Q1 2026 net loss per share of -$0.60, missing the consensus estimate of -$0.5516 by 8.77%. The company, which remains in the pre-revenue stage, generated no revenue during the quarter. Despite the earnings miss, the stock edged up 0.28% in the session following the release, suggesting market focus remains on upcoming clinical milestones rather than near-term financial results.

As a clinical-stage biotechnology company, Cogent Biosciences reported no revenue for Q1 2026, consistent with the pre-commercialization phase. The GAAP net loss of -$0.60 per share was primarily driven by research and development expenses related to the advancement of its lead pipeline candidate, a selective KIT D816V inhibitor targeting systemic mastocytosis and other KIT-driven diseases. Operational highlights during the quarter likely included ongoing patient enrollment in registrational trials, expansion of clinical sites, and manufacturing scale-up activities. While the EPS miss may raise near-term cost concerns, the company’s focus on executing its clinical development plan remains central. Cash burn from operations is a key metric for investors, though specific cash and runway figures were not provided in the data. Management continues to prioritize data generation from its pivotal programs, with several readouts anticipated in upcoming periods. Margin trends are not applicable given the absence of revenue, but R&D spending as a percentage of operating expenses may remain elevated during this intense clinical phase. Cogent Biosciences did not issue formal financial guidance for the remainder of fiscal 2026, which is typical for pre-revenue biotechnology companies. However, management may have provided qualitative updates on expected milestones, including potential regulatory interactions and timelines for top-line data from ongoing trials. The company anticipates that its current cash balance, if disclosed, might support operations through key inflection points, but additional financing could be considered to extend the runway. Strategic priorities include completing enrollment in the registrational trial for bezuclastinib in non-advanced systemic mastocytosis, initiating additional indications, and advancing earlier-stage assets. Risk factors include clinical trial delays, competitive developments in the mastocytosis landscape, and potential dilutive capital raises. The wider-than-expected net loss may accelerate the need for cost-control measures or partnership discussions. Investors should monitor updates on trial enrollment rates and any safety or efficacy signals that could affect regulatory pathways. The modest stock increase of 0.28% following the Q1 miss suggests that the earnings shortfall was largely anticipated or secondary to longer-term pipeline catalysts. Analyst commentary may have focused on the integrity of ongoing clinical programs rather than the quarterly loss, as pre-revenue biotech valuations are tied to drug approval probabilities. Some analysts might view the higher loss as a necessary investment in a promising asset, while others could express caution about cash burn without near-term milestones. Key factors to watch include upcoming patient enrollment updates, topline data readouts from the registrational trial, and any news on partnerships or financing. The stock’s reaction implies that the market is pricing in a binary outcome around future data releases. Investors should assess the company’s ability to meet enrollment targets and manage expenses while advancing its pipeline. Without revenue, the path to profitability remains contingent on successful development and eventual commercialization.
